Two daring friends spend a frosty afternoon racing an improvised iceboat across the frozen Big Bear River, laughing and shouting as the wind whips around them. Their high‑speed adventure quickly turns chaotic when the boat capsizes, sending them sliding across the slick ice and scrambling for safety. Shivering and breathless, they manage to right the vessel and head back toward the lonely Riverview Yacht Club, hoping to find warmth and a ride home.

When they reach the parking area, the girls are stunned to discover their car gone, replaced only by a mysterious, unpainted two‑wheel trailer whose tires are still imprinted in the fresh snow. The empty space where their vehicle should be feels oddly unsettling, as if something unseen has slipped away with it. Their curiosity ignites, and the girls begin to wonder whether the winter landscape hides more than just cold.

What lurks beyond the silent gate of the deserted club? As the wind howls and the night draws near, the girls are drawn into a puzzling mystery that promises a blend of suspense, friendship, and a hint of the supernatural—perfect for listeners who love a chilly thrill.

About the author

Mildred A. (Mildred Augustine) Wirt

Mildred A. (Mildred Augustine) Wirt

1905–2002

Best known as the first writer behind many of the earliest Nancy Drew mysteries, this prolific author helped shape generations of young readers' love of suspense and adventure. She went on to write dozens of books for children and worked for many years as a journalist.
